Prince Armand knows he can be a good ruler. Unfortunately, his father can't see past Armand's stutter and would rather marry him off to strengthen their alliances than listen to him. Unbeknownst to Armand, however, the future of his people and of his happiness rests in the hands of the kingdom's most notorious thief, the Magpie.

Cyn's only hope for redemption from her role in her father's death lies in saving her family from the streets. Under her stepmother's direction, Cyn prepares for her biggest-and hopefully last-heist: robbing the gentry blind at the upcoming masquerade ball. But when the handsome prince catches Cyn in the act, sparks fly and an unusual deal is struck: her freedom in exchange for nightly conversation.

Nothing is as it seems, though, and as war looms on the horizon, two proud hearts must learn to trust, forgive, and find the confidence they need in order to save the kingdom and themselves.

About the author










Rebecca Gage writes to see if dreams really do come true and if happily ever afters exist (they totally do). To escape her boring, mundane non-magical roots, she ran away to BYU and managed to get an education with lots of writing credentials behind her. She even placed first in a writing contest-she may or may not have been its only contestant. She resides in Colorado with her husband and gaggle of children, and she is plotting how to secretly raise chickens without getting caught by the HOA.
